Technical Specifications

Side-by-side comparison of Turion X2 RM-75 and Atom D525

AMD

Turion X2 RM-75

The Turion X2 RM-75 is manufactured by AMD. It was released in 2007-01-01. It is based on the Lion (2008−2009) architecture. It features 2 cores and 2 threads. Max frequency: 2.2 GHz. L3 cache: 0 kB. L2 cache: 1 MB. Built on 65 nm process technology. Socket: S1. Thermal design power (TDP): 1 MB. Passmark benchmark score: 1,717 points. Launch price was $69.

Intel

Atom D525

The Atom D525 is manufactured by Intel. It was released in 21 June 2010 (15 years ago). It is based on the Pinetrail (2009−2011) architecture. It features 2 cores and 4 threads. Base frequency is 1.8 GHz, with boost up to 1.83 GHz. L3 cache: 0 kB. L2 cache: 512K (per core). Built on 45 nm process technology. Socket: FCBGA559. Thermal design power (TDP): 13 Watt. Memory support: DDR2, DDR3. Passmark benchmark score: 1,707 points. Launch price was $63.

Processing Power

The Turion X2 RM-75 packs 2 cores / 2 threads, matching the Atom D525's 2 cores. Boost clocks reach 2.2 GHz on the Turion X2 RM-75 versus 1.83 GHz on the Atom D525 — a 18.4% clock advantage for the Turion X2 RM-75. The Turion X2 RM-75 uses the Lion (2008−2009) architecture (65 nm), while the Atom D525 uses Pinetrail (2009−2011) (45 nm). In PassMark, the Turion X2 RM-75 scores 1,717 against the Atom D525's 1,707 — a 0.6% lead for the Turion X2 RM-75. Both processors carry 0 kB of L3 cache.

Memory & Platform

The Turion X2 RM-75 uses the S1 socket (PCIe 2.0), while the Atom D525 uses FCBGA559 (PCIe 2.0) — making them incompatible on the same motherboard.
